Congratulations to Peterson YMCA and Smith YMCA of Huntington Beach on achieving the distinguished honor of becoming nationally accredited by the National Afterschool Association (NAA). Under the direction of Tomia Hicks (Director-Peterson YMCA) and Penny Andrews (Director-Smith YMCA), these two programs have demonstrated through their commitment to providing the highest level of quality of after school programming. The accreditation process takes up to one year to complete and requires staff, parents and children to work together to meet the 144 standards included in the NAA Standards for Quality School-Age Care. Examples include meeting developmentally different needs of children, involving children in program planning, providing positive interactions between children and adults and ensuring a safe and enriching environment for children. NAA President and CEO, Judy Nee explains, "Accreditation is the hallmark of program quality. NAA has been promoting quality since its inception in 1987, and the accreditation process (launched in 1998) gives programs a way to show, in measurable terms, they are a cut above the rest."
